It’s the airplane that EVERYONE wants to fly... the single seat, one-third scale, flying replica of one of America’s greatest bombers... the mighty B-17.
A labor of love for one great man, the presence of the “Bally Bomber’ is a jaw-dropper! The One Week Wonder is back for AirVenture 2018! Over the next seven days, thousands of EAA members will come together to put together a brand new Vans RV-12is. The build kicked off at 8am sharp Monday morning…. The Manufacturer of some of the world’s mightiest single engine turboprops, the TBM 910 and TBM 930, Daher is unveiling new capabilities for its airplanes and aggressive support programs for its owners at AirVenture 2018. Pipistrel brought not just one, but TWO, electric airplanes to AirVenture 2018. Both aircraft are in serial production and available to the flying public... right now... and the latest news is that they have figured out a way for you to fly for free.
